				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Posted in <a href="http://www.promoguy.net/archives/monday-mission/" title="Monday Mission">Monday Mission</a></p><p>Monster.com has a new spin on the tired old &#8220;Hot or Not&#8221; theme.</p>
<p>They call it &#8220;<a href="http://survey.monster.com/hireorfire/index.asp" target="_blank">Hire or Fire</a>.&#8221; It only lets you cylcle through about 6 people before it ends with an ad for Monster.com&#8217;s services. But if you <a href="http://survey.monster.com/hireorfire/index.asp" target="_blank">reload the main link</a>, it shows new faces.</p>
<p>It is a clever ad, but man, some of the people on there you just have to wonder about. I mean, <a href="http://survey.monster.com/hireorfire/index.asp?WT.mc_n=MN;A05;CT;00;A;07;I7ZA&#038;ImageID=25&#038;HIREFIRE=Hire" target="_blank">where did they get these photos</a>?</p>
<p>But on the flipside, there is nothing fun about being fired.</p>
<p>At my last job &#8220;The Powers That Be&#8221; laid off, well, fired the entire staff in our division and closed their doors. Before that, I was sh*tcanned by new management who wanted their own players. Getting fired isn&#8217;t fun.</p>
<p>Why do they still use the phrase &#8220;lay off?&#8221; I never hear of anyone being brought back after being &#8220;Laid Off.&#8221; Do they think we don&#8217;t know the difference? Like being laid off doesn&#8217;t hurt as bad as being fired? Different words, same meaning folks.</p>
<p>Whichever you call it, it still makes you feel worthless. Devastated. Like you have nothing left.</p>
<p>None of my fire-ings ever came at a good time in my life, and they always left me feeling like I&#8217;d lost a little bit of myself.</p>
<p>Maybe it is just me, but I often let my job become too much of who I. I take too much pride in it, in a job well done. And for what? To take a lot of crap just to work for &#8220;da Man?&#8221; To always be in the department they elminate first (Marketing)? To go to work every day, thinking I a team player only to the blown out of the water when the numbers don&#8217;t add up? </p>
<p>Where is the loyalty? Gone, that&#8217;s where.</p>
<p>Employers expect you to be totally loyal to them, to never say a bad word, to support their stupid decisions, to blindly follow their lead. Then they blindside you with a pink slip right outta nowhere! Yeah, so much for loyalty.</p>
<p>So much for trust.</p>
<p>Yeah, still a little bitter ain&#8217;t I?</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Posted in <a href="http://www.promoguy.net/archives/monday-mission/" title="Monday Mission">Monday Mission</a></p><p>As Christine pointed out a few days ago, the Monday Mission turned 2 on December 3rd, 2003!</p>
<p>Even though we are at Monday Mission 3.48, the<a href="http://www.promoguy.net/archives/000372.php" target="_blank"> first Monday Mission</a> pretty much resembles the <a href="http://www.promoguy.net/archives/002296.php" target="_blank">Missions we have today</a>, if it ain&#8217;t broke, don&#8217;t fix it. By the way, our very first Monday Missionaries were <a href="http://www.theworkingmom.net/archives/003052.php" target="_blank">Jennifer</a> and <a href="http://www.bigpinkcookie.com/archives/000943.html" target="_blank">Christine</a>! Wow, that was a loooooooooooong time ago, wasn&#8217;t it?</p>
<p>Theazing part is, I still friends with both of them. Well, it isn&#8217;t thatazing, they are both incredible people I just mean that as internet relationships go, things get touchy and many folks have a falling out after a while. But not in this case, and I find that mighty impressive.</p>
<p>You may be wondering how it can be almost to version 4.0 and still be only 2 years old. Well, having started it in December (near year&#8217;s end), version 1.0 only ran for a few weeks before being upgraded to 2.0 Make sense?</p>
<p>So, why I ending the Monday Mission in January? Well, for one reason, I wanted to take it to an even 4.0. I just like things nice and orderly. Why else? </p>
<p>Frankly, it is a wear out to produce. Every week for 2 years I&#8217;ve churned out a Monday Mission and sooner or later, that takes a toll. Honestly, I&#8217;ve asked about all the questions I can think of. Plus, I not having fun with it. When something that was fun turns into a chore or something you dread, why continue to do it? Besdies that, there is the fear that I might only be known for running the MM, and hopefully, I more than just a meme guy.</p>
<p>Now, I not opposed to &#8220;editing&#8221; a Monday Mission that others might provide. Maybe 12 people can commit to doing a month of MM&#8217;s each? Then I would tweak it here and there and post it. Let it live on it&#8217;s own Domain in a simple Blog devoted to the MM + comments and nothing else. Then again, I don&#8217;t want to buy another domain name, nor do I have the urge to design a site (any takers?).</p>
<p>Maybe something like: <i>&#8220;PromoGuy&#8217;s Monday Mission by YourNameHere of YourSiteHere.&#8221;</i></p>
<p>But I would have to hope that those who want to write it would actually deliver (in advance, so I can edit them) and that you, dear reader, would enjoy a MM produced by someone else.</p>
<p>As for me, I think it would inject some life into a meme that has seen better days.</p>
<p>Then again, if that doesn&#8217;t pan out then I will just put it to rest. I don&#8217;t think I could release the Monday Mission to someone else to run on another site.</p>
<p>Either way, it is nice to see the MM reach its 2nd Birthday! I couldn&#8217;t have done it without you, so thank you for making it happen.</p>
